要实现从远程服务器API1检索到的list<A>,查询另一个API2得到A的list<B>,最后返回两个查询结果list<A+B>,可以按照以下步骤进行:
- 首先,需要使用合适的编程语言和框架来进行开发。根据你的要求,可以选择前端开发中常用的HTML、CSS和JavaScript,后端开发中常用的Java、Python、Node.js等语言。
- 在前端部分,可以使用AJAX或Fetch等技术来调用API1并获取list<A>。这些技术可以通过发送HTTP请求到API1的URL,并处理返回的JSON数据。
- 在后端部分,可以使用相应的编程语言和框架来处理前端发送的请求,并调用API2来获取list<B>。可以使用HTTP客户端库或内置的HTTP请求功能来发送请求,并解析返回的JSON数据。
- 在获取到list<A>和list<B>后,可以将它们进行合并,生成list<A+B>。具体的合并方式取决于数据结构和业务需求,可以使用循环遍历、映射函数等方法来实现。
- 最后,将合并后的list<A+B>返回给前端进行展示。可以将数据转换为JSON格式,并通过HTTP响应返回给前端。
在这个过程中,可以使用一些常见的开发工具和技术来提高开发效率和代码质量。例如,使用版本控制工具(如Git)来管理代码,使用单元测试框架来测试代码的正确性,使用日志工具来记录运行时的信息等。
对于云计算领域的相关知识,可以根据具体的需求和场景选择合适的腾讯云产品来支持开发。例如,可以使用腾讯云的云服务器(CVM)来部署后端应用,使用对象存储(COS)来存储和管理数据,使用云函数(SCF)来实现无服务器架构等。具体的产品选择可以根据实际需求和腾讯云的产品文档进行参考。
请注意,由于要求不能提及其他云计算品牌商,因此无法提供其他品牌商的相关产品和链接。